Front Caster and Camber Adjustment

  1. Loosen the lower control arm cam bolt nuts.
  2. Rotate the cam bolts to the required caster or camber specification setting. Refer to Wheel Alignment Specifications .
  3. NOTE: Refer to Fastener Notice in Cautions and Notices.
  4. Maintain the caster or camber setting while tightening the cam bolt nuts.

    Tighten:  Tighten the front lower control arm cam bolt nuts to 170 N.m (125 lb ft).

  5. IMPORTANT: Check the toe setting AFTER changing camber or caster.
  6. Check the caster and camber settings after tightening.
  7. Adjust the caster and camber setting if necessary.
